Plantains are native to India and are grown most widely in tropical climates.
-
Plantains are sometimes referred to as the pasta and potatoes of the Caribbean.
-
Sold in the fresh produce section of the supermarket, they usually resemble green bananas but ripe plantains may be black in color. T
This vegetable-banana can be eaten and tastes different at every stage of development. The interior color of the fruit will remain creamy, yellowish or lightly pink. When the peel is green to yellow, the flavor of the flesh is bland and its texture is starchy. As the peel changes to brown or black, it has a sweeter flavor and more of a banana aroma, but still keeps a firm shape when cooked.
